For Daily Protection
The Prep: Gather dried seaweed sheets, a drizzle of olive oil, and your favorite seasoning. You can choose sea salt, garlic powder, or sesame seeds to enhance the flavor.
The Action: Preheat your oven to 350°F. Lightly brush the seaweed sheets with olive oil and sprinkle your chosen seasoning evenly. Place the sheets on a baking tray and roast for about 10 minutes, watching closely to prevent burning.
The Feeling: Once cooled, these crispy snacks will have a delightful crunch. You may experience a satisfying umami flavor that lingers, providing an energizing boost throughout your day.
Pro Tip: Store any leftovers in an airtight container to maintain their crispiness.

The Nighttime Routine
The Prep: Prepare a bowl of miso soup and gather your seaweed snacks. You can use instant miso packets for convenience.
The Action: Heat water and dissolve the miso paste according to package instructions. Break the seaweed snacks into smaller pieces and add them to the soup just before serving.
The Feeling: The warm soup will create a soothing sensation, while the seaweed adds a subtle depth of flavor. You may feel relaxed and satisfied, perfect for winding down before bed.
Pro Tip: Adding tofu or vegetables can increase the nutritional value of your nighttime meal.

Overconsumption of Seaweed
While seaweed is nutritious, consuming excessive amounts can lead to an overload of iodine. This can disrupt thyroid function and cause health issues.
Moderation is key. Aim for a balanced intake that allows you to enjoy the benefits without overdoing it. Incorporating seaweed snacks into your diet a few times a week can provide the nutrients you need without risk.

The Science Behind Seaweed Snacks
The biological mechanisms at play in seaweed are fascinating. Seaweed is a unique plant that absorbs nutrients from seawater, leading to a rich profile of vitamins and minerals. This absorption process allows seaweed to be a potent source of omega-3 fatty acids, which are essential for heart health and cognitive function.
Key compounds in seaweed, such as alginate and fucoidan, have been shown to possess antioxidant properties. These compounds can help combat oxidative stress and promote overall well-being. The presence of iodine in seaweed is particularly beneficial for thyroid health, as it plays a crucial role in hormone production.

Who Should Avoid This?
– Individuals with thyroid disorders should consult a healthcare provider before consuming seaweed snacks.
– Those with allergies to seaweed or iodine should avoid these snacks entirely.
– Pregnant or breastfeeding women should limit intake and discuss with a healthcare professional.
Common Questions
Are seaweed snacks gluten-free?
Yes, most seaweed snacks are naturally gluten-free. Always check the packaging for any potential cross-contamination.
Can children eat seaweed snacks?
Yes, children can enjoy seaweed snacks in moderation. Ensure they are age-appropriate and free from choking hazards.
How should I store seaweed snacks?
Store seaweed snacks in a cool, dry place in an airtight container to maintain their crispiness.
Do seaweed snacks contain added sugars?
Some seaweed snacks may contain added sugars. Always read the ingredient label to ensure you are making a healthy choice.
